Amplify Credit Union Proves a Good Mobile Banking Demo is Worth a Thousand Words

By Eric Mattson on June 8, 2007 11:31 AM | 0 Comments

Once banks have jumped the technological mobile-banking shark, the next challenge is educating customers about how mobile banking works and the advantages of using it. As we've mentioned before, answering the basic questions up front is incredibly important at this stage in adoption.

amplify_logo_fade.jpgOne great way to go beyond simple text for explanation is to create a demo of your mobile banking experience on your website. Amplify Federal Credit Union and mShift (its mobile banking technology provider) have done just that, and it is truly worth a thousand words.

mshift_logo.gifYou should definitely check out the mobile banking demo (to sign onto the demo, use amplify as the account number and pda as the PIN). It shows what the mobile banking experience would be like on a Treo. We recommend that you consider a similar approach. A video tour might also be a great option.
